| Proof Load (psi) | Stainless Steel A2 & A4 | ||
|---|---|---|---|
| Property Class 50 | 72500 | ||
| Property Class 70 | 101500 | ||
| Property Class 80 | 116000 | ||
| Hardness is not a measurable attribute of Stainless Steel | |||
